Ilves Naiset
Tampereen Ilves Naiset are an ice hockey team in the Auroraliiga. They are the representative women's team of the multi-sport club Ilves, based in Tampere, and their home arena is in Tampere's Tesoma district.
Ilves is the only team that has played in every season since the establishment of the Naisten SM-sarja in 1982. The team ranks second on the list of most Aurora Borealis Cup wins, with ten, and has claimed the most Finnish Championship medals in league history, with ten gold, twelve silver, and six bronze for 28 total medals.

Team records and leaders
Regular season
;Career records- Most points: Marianne Ihalainen, 602 points
- Most points, defenseman: Anna Aaltomaa, 203 points
- Most goals: Marianne Ihalainen, 320 goals
- Most assists: Johanna Koivula, 302 assists
- Highest points per game, over 30 games played: Linda Leppänen, 2.11 P/G
- Most penalty minutes : Johanna Koivula, 323 PIM
- Most games played, skater: Johanna Koivula, 495 games
- Most games played, goaltender: Viivi Vartia-Koivisto, 98 games
- Best save percentage, over 25 games played: Anni Keisala,.937 Sv%
- Best goals against average, over 25 games played: Camilla Kortesniemi, 2.12 GAA
